Jackson JS11 Dinky AH Metallic Red Electric guitar
The Jackson JS11 Dinky AH Metallic Red is a budget-friendly superstrat electric guitar built for rock and metal players who want serious tone without breaking the bank. It pairs a poplar body with a bolt-on maple neck and an amaranth fingerboard, delivering the classic Dinky feel at an entry-level price.
- Poplar body with a 2-point fulcrum tremolo bridge for dive-bombs and expressive pitch bends
- Maple speed neck reinforced with graphite for rock-solid tuning stability
- Two Jackson high-output ceramic-magnet humbuckers deliver punchy, modern crunch into any amp or modeler
- 22 jumbo frets on a flat 12-inch radius amaranth fingerboard
Jackson JS11 Dinky AH Metallic Red: A Workhorse Superstrat for Rock and Metal
The Jackson JS11 Dinky AH Metallic Red delivers the brand's signature aggressive tone and stage-ready looks in one of the most affordable packages in the JS Series. Built around a poplar body and a bolt-on maple speed neck with graphite reinforcement, this superstrat is engineered for players who want classic Jackson character without flagship pricing. Finished in Metallic Red with all-black hardware and a pointed 6-in-line headstock, this model carries the menacing visual identity that has defined the brand for decades.
What Makes This Guitar Stand Out in Its Category
Inside the JS11 Dinky, a graphite-reinforced maple neck with a scarf joint adds stability under heavy string tension. The 2-point fulcrum tremolo pivots smoothly on two contact points, allowing expressive dive-bombs without sacrificing tuning. A pair of Jackson high-output ceramic-magnet humbuckers delivers the punch and bite that metal players expect.
Poplar Body and Bolt-On Neck — Built for Stability and Comfort
Lightweight poplar keeps the instrument comfortable during long sessions while providing a balanced tonal foundation. A bolt-on maple neck with graphite reinforcement resists warping through temperature changes and aggressive playing. Multiple comfort contours and recessed plates let the guitar sit naturally against the player.
- Body Material: Poplar — lightweight and resonant, easy on the shoulder during long sets
- Neck Construction: Bolt-on maple with graphite reinforcement and scarf joint — rock-solid stability under heavy use
- Gloss Metallic Red finish paired with all-black hardware for a cohesive, stage-ready look
Fast Neck and Flat Fingerboard Radius for Shred-Ready Playability
Finished in satin, the maple speed neck allows smooth hand movement up and down the fretboard. A flat 12-inch fingerboard radius encourages easier chording and comfortable bending, while 22 jumbo frets give players room for high-position lead lines. The amaranth fingerboard provides a dense playing surface that responds cleanly under both rhythm chugging and fast lead runs.
- Scale Length: 648 mm (25.5") — long-scale tension for tight low-end and crisp note definition
- Fingerboard Radius: 305 mm (12") — flat surface ideal for bending and fast lead playing
- Amaranth fingerboard — dense dark wood supporting clean articulation
- Nut Width: 42.86 mm (1.6875") — comfortable string spacing for rhythm and lead styles
High-Output Humbuckers and a 2-Point Tremolo for Modern Metal Tone
Two Jackson high-output humbucking pickups with ceramic magnets form the heart of this model's voice, delivering aggressive crunch and tight chugs through any amp or modeler. A 3-position blade switch, single volume, and single tone control keep the layout simple and effective. The 2-point fulcrum tremolo allows expressive pitch manipulation, while Jackson sealed die-cast tuners hold tuning reliably.
- Pickup Configuration: HH (Jackson High-Output Humbucking) — ceramic magnets deliver punchy, modern tone
- 2-Point Fulcrum Tremolo bridge — smooth action for dive-bombs and subtle vibrato
- Tuning Machines: Jackson Sealed Die-Cast — stable tuning across aggressive playing
- Strings: Nickel Plated Steel (.009-.042) — light gauge set ready for bending and lead work

Тype: Superstrat
The Superstrat is a type of electric guitar based on the design of the Stratocaster, but modified for a more aggressive style of playing, especially in the hard rock and metal genres. It has a solid body, often with powerful humbucker pickups for a more powerful and distorted sound. Superstrat guitars often have an improved tremolo system (like the Floyd Rose) and a faster neck for technical playing. This type of guitar is designed for the modern guitarist who demands more versatility and performance.
Finish: Polished
The glossy finish gives any surface an elegant and luxurious look. This type of finish is achieved by applying several layers of lacquer or resin, which are then polished to a high gloss. This provides a smooth, reflective finish, enhancing color and structure of substrate. The glossy finish not only improves aesthetics, but also protects against dust, moisture and minor scratches.
Body: Poplar
Poplar is a medium-light wood that produces a well-balanced tone with an emphasis on the mid-range and soft bass. It has a smooth and neutral tonal characteristics. This makes it a versatile material for a wide range of musical styles. Poplar is often used for its affordability and consistent tonal characteristics.
Neck: Maple
Maple is known for its strength and stability, making it ideal for necks that need to resist bending and warping.
Fretboard: Amaranth
Amaranth, also known as purple heart, is a hardwood with a distinctive purple color. It offers clear, balanced tone with fast response. It is durable and stable, making it a reliable material for fingerboards, while giving the instrument a unique and aesthetically distinctive look.
Pickups Configuration: HH
The humbucker-humbucker configuration means that the guitar is equipped with two humbucker pickups. It offers a powerful, full sound with high output and low noise, ideal for rock and metal.

AI summary of reviews
Based on the number of reviews: 118
Strengths
- Value for money: Customers consistently highlight the guitar's excellent quality and performance relative to its affordable price, making it a great deal.
- Beginner-friendly: Many reviewers find this guitar ideal for new players due to its ease of play and overall suitability for learning.
- Aesthetic appeal: The guitar receives frequent compliments for its attractive design and finish, especially in red.
- Sound quality: Customers are generally pleased with the guitar's sound, noting its good resonance and ability to produce excellent tones, particularly for metal genres.
- Playability: The guitar is described as easy to play, with a comfortable fretboard that makes it enjoyable for users.
Weaknesses
- Initial setup required: Some customers report that the guitar may require minor adjustments, such as soldering a cable or setting up the action, upon arrival.
- Rough fretboard finish: The fretboard and neck may have a somewhat rough finish, which can cause frets to creak during bending.
- Pickup sound profile: Opinions are split on the pickups, with some customers noting that the sound may not fully match the classic Jackson tone found in more expensive models.
